Key Insights

  • The considerable ownership by individual investors in Aidite (Qinhuangdao) Technology indicates that they collectively have a greater say in management and business strategy
  • The top 5 shareholders own 52% of the company
  • Insider ownership in Aidite (Qinhuangdao) Technology is 29%

If you want to know who really controls Aidite (Qinhuangdao) Technology Co., Ltd. (SZSE:301580), then you'll have to look at the makeup of its share registry. With 35% stake, individual investors possess the maximum shares in the company. Put another way, the group faces the maximum upside potential (or downside risk).

While individual investors were the group that benefitted the most from last week's CN¥1.0b market cap gain, insiders too had a 29% share in those profits.

Hedge funds don't have many shares in Aidite (Qinhuangdao) Technology. The company's largest shareholder is Hongwen Li, with ownership of 18%. In comparison, the second and third largest shareholders hold about 13% and 11% of the stock.

To make our study more interesting, we found that the top 5 shareholders control more than half of the company which implies that this group has considerable sway over the company's decision-making.

Insider Ownership Of Aidite (Qinhuangdao) Technology

The definition of an insider can differ slightly between different countries, but members of the board of directors always count. The company management answer to the board and the latter should represent the interests of shareholders. Notably, sometimes top-level managers are on the board themselves.

Insider ownership is positive when it signals leadership are thinking like the true owners of the company. However, high insider ownership can also give immense power to a small group within the company. This can be negative in some circumstances.

It seems insiders own a significant proportion of Aidite (Qinhuangdao) Technology Co., Ltd.. It has a market capitalization of just CN¥4.8b, and insiders have CN¥1.4b worth of shares in their own names. It is great to see insiders so invested in the business. General Public Ownership

The general public, who are usually individual investors, hold a 35% stake in Aidite (Qinhuangdao) Technology. While this group can't necessarily call the shots, it can certainly have a real influence on how the company is run.

Private Equity Ownership

Private equity firms hold a 19% stake in Aidite (Qinhuangdao) Technology. This suggests they can be influential in key policy decisions. Some investors might be encouraged by this, since private equity are sometimes able to encourage strategies that help the market see the value in the company. Alternatively, those holders might be exiting the investment after taking it public.

Private Company Ownership

Our data indicates that Private Companies hold 7.8%, of the company's shares. Private companies may be related parties. Sometimes insiders have an interest in a public company through a holding in a private company, rather than in their own capacity as an individual.
